Course Information :

I pursued Mechanical Engineering here, and I'm really satisfied. The autonomous status has brought positive changes, like the invention studio for robotics and the electro lounge for circuit making. Plus, the CATIA training is a huge advantage!

Fee Structure :

The fee structure for Mechanical Engineering is pretty reasonable, around ₹55,389 per year. It's definitely worth the investment considering the quality of education and the resources they provide. They also have options for scholarships which is great.
